Demos on the platforms I've mentioned above are great, but I love Amiga demos most of all because the Amiga is like a bridge between the old 8-bit retro hardware of the 1970s and 80s, and the modern PC - the system came out in 1985 and has both the oldschool look of the late 80s, but the great design and interesting ideas that PC demos use, even if graphically (even with AGA) it cannot hope to touch the latest PC demos. Besides, I love what Amiga coders like Britelite can do with relatively limited hardware.
And above all, I love what Paula, a sound chip from 1985, can achieve aurally, which is damned impressive considering it is around 34 years old! |
